English Language and Literature, A Level
The English Language & Literature A Level covers the study of non-fiction texts, along with written novels, poetry, and plays. You will analyse a wide range of literary texts from different time periods and cultures, gaining an understanding of the types of language used in different contexts.
Show more...What will I study?
This programme will allow you to explore many examples of prose along with different readers and audiences. You will do your own writing and study literary texts, including Shakespeare.
Group discussion forms a large part of this programme, and you will have plenty of scope for your own creative work. You will also explore how writers adapt their style to suit their audience, the different ways we use language when we talk and when we write, how writers create voices, how the development of internet technologies is affecting language usage and much more.

How will I be assessed?
Exams (80%) and coursework (20%) in your second year.
Progression
This programme can help you secure a place on a wide range of university courses, which can open doors to many career paths including creative writing, journalism, marketing, politics and history.
Entry requirements
A minimum of five GCSEs at grade 9-4, including maths and a 5 in GCSE English Language and English Literature.
